1990 Wyoming gubernatorial election
The Wyoming gubernatorial election of 1990 took place on November 6, 1990. Incumbent Democrat Mike Sullivan ran for re-election as Governor of Wyoming. Sullivan defeated Republican businesswoman Mary Mead.

Democratic primary
Candidates
- Mike Sullivan, incumbent Governor
- Ron Clingman, mechanic
Party | Candidate | Votes | % | |
---|---|---|---|---|
Democratic | Mike Sullivan (inc.) | 38,447 | 88.44 | |
Democratic | Ron Clingman | 5,026 | 11.56 | |
Total votes | 43,473 | 100 |
Republican primary
Candidates
- Mary Mead, businesswoman and daughter of former Governor Clifford Hansen
- Nyla Murphy, State Representative
Party | Candidate | Votes | % | |
---|---|---|---|---|
Republican | Mary Mead | 51,560 | 67.25 | |
Republican | Nyla Murphy | 24,916 | 32.75 | |
Total votes | 76,476 | 100 |
Results
Party | Candidate | Votes | % | ± |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Democratic | Mike Sullivan (inc.) | 104,638 | 65.35 | ||
Republican | Mary Mead | 55,471 | 34.65 | ||
Total votes | '160,109' | '100' |
